The point is during a live commentary for “Day of the Moon” he said that he likes to pull a Hitchcock and work himself into everything he directs in the form of his hands. Like, if there’s an insert (cut-away close-up) of hands in his things, they’re usually/often his hands, and not the actors’ hands (he said he even shot his hands in drag once, lol). It’s actually really usual for hand inserts to be someone else’s hands, as those things are usually shot last and it’s cheaper to just send the actors home and use someone else who doesn’t cost as much to keep on set.
